Output 3d85bede30dfdb2cb7a548eea054c64344499c98b2f56379c45083128fbd2923:0

value
6426239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6c2cbb7b92785d8353bd086e18c3f4a8ee5cbb OP_EQUAL
address
377DNyTK4rqYkiE6Qe5cdx9nDNDcgJY18E
transaction
3d85bede30dfdb2cb7a548eea054c64344499c98b2f56379c45083128fbd2923
spent
true